Transaction f17c56f62b3c237156b9c762d66b94f2afe104d17c0fdb39d449be88639803d7
1 Input
1 Output
-
f17c56f62b3c237156b9c762d66b94f2afe104d17c0fdb39d449be88639803d7:0
- value
- 675375
- script pubkey
- OP_0 OP_PUSHBYTES_20 a0ef22a591fa8da607e55e6cb93a67c21c09d4e3
- address
- bc1q5rhj9fv3l2x6vpl9tektjwn8cgwqn48rlgsmmc